How this data was collected

Data Hunt Guide aggregates publicly available sighting reports from across the web — social media, hunting forums, harvest reports, and trail-camera shares — and uses a proprietary algorithm to identify high-activity zones (hotspots) within each unit. Our team verifies coordinates manually before publication. Unit 391’s 410 sightings represent 45 distinct hotspot clusters.
